In 1861, Sarah Virginia Banks entered the world in Mercer County, Virginia, USA, born to Andrew Jackson Banks Joshua Banks And Elizabeth Betty Bailey. In 1900, Sarah Virginia Banks resided in Washington, Kanawha, West Virginia, USA. Sarah Virginia Banks married John Edward Templeton, and had children including Bessie Marie Templeton, Bettie Mae Templeton, Beverly Jackson Templeton, Dewey M Templeton, Dodie Templeton, Dorothy M Pauley, Orah Edison Templeton. Sarah Virginia Banks passed away in 1950 in Saint Albans, Kanawha County, West Virginia, United States of America.
